Интеграции
Этот мод старается быть совместимым с большинством существующих модов/плагинов. Ниже представлен список текущих существующих интеграций.
Если вы хотите видеть поддержку другого мода/плагина, создайте feature request.
Плагины чата
Если установлен поддерживаемый плагин, сообщения пересылаются между Telegram чатами, настроенными в chats[], и чатами с одинаковыми именами, настроенными в вашем плагине.
Поддерживаемые плагины:
- Chatty
- HeroChat
- Carbon Chat (Paper, Fabric)
- FlectonePulse (Paper, Fabric)
Статус поддержки других плагинов: #71. Если вам нужна поддержка вашего плагина, оставьте комментарий под этим issue. До добавления поддержки вы можете использовать костыль ниже.
Неподдерживаемые плагины чата
Чтобы использовать tgbridge с неподдерживаемыми плагинами, задайте опцию integrations.incompatiblePluginChatPrefix. Она использует костыль для работы с любым плагином, но некоторые функции могут работать неправильно. Например, игроки в "муте" все равно смогут отправлять сообщения в Telegram-чат. Также в этом режиме поддерживается только один (глобальный) чат.
DiscordSRV
Сообщения пересылаются между Telegram чатами и Discord каналами с одинаковыми именами в конфигах tgbridge и DiscordSRV.
Формат сообщений можно настроить в секции конфига integrations.discord.
Vanish
Для игроков в ванише не отправляются сообщения входа/выхода, также эти игроки скрыты в команде /list в Telegram.
Работает из коробки с:
Клиентские моды для эмодзи/замена текста
Эта интеграция заменяет паттерны текста в сообщениях, пересылаемых из Minecraft в Telegram, используя правила из файла replacements.json.
По умолчанию replacements.json содержит список частых эмодзи-шорткатов, таких как :fox: или :skull:. Он должен быть совместим с большинством модов, которые заменяют шорткаты на клиенте. Также можно настроить замену любого текста на любой другой текст.
Голосовые сообщения
Если установлен мод/плагин Voice Messages, голосовые сообщения будут пересылаться между Minecraft и Telegram.
Другие
BlueMap + Xaero's Minimap/Xaero's World Map: показывает отправленные в чат вейпойнты как ссылки на BlueMap. Задайте опцию
integrations.bluemapUrlчтобы использовать.Форматирование сообщений, отправленных в игре с помощью StyledChat или похожего мода/плагина, будет видно в Telegram.
Если spark установлен, то в Телеграме будет доступна команда
/tps
